Columbite-(Fe) is a mineral that is fairly common rarely available as a faceted gem mostly since it is opaque black to brownish black. However, it could be somewhat attractive having its vitreous to luster that is sub-metallic when its surfaces tarnish and become iredescent. Columbite-(Fe) is relatively hard with a Mohs hardness of 6.0 and ...

columbite, hard, black (often iridescent), heavy oxide mineral of iron, manganese, and niobium, (Fe, Mn)Nb 2 O 6. Tantalum atoms replace niobium atoms in the crystal structure to form the mineral tantalite, which is similar but much more dense.These minerals are the most abundant and widespread of the naturally occurring niobates and tantalates and …

The criteria for a mineral to belong to the columbite supergroup are: the general stoichiometry MO 2; the crystal structure based on the hexagonal close packing (hcp) of anions (or close to it); the six-fold coordination number of M-type cations (augmented to eight-fold in the case of slight distortion of hcp); and the presence of zig …
Columbite-group minerals occur in all main parageneses of the pegmatites and form four generations, reflecting the sequence of pegmatite formation. These minerals demonstrate wide variations in the content of major and trace elements. The composition of CGM ranges from columbite-(Fe) to tantalite-(Mn).

Columbite-Fe is an uncommon mineral that occurs generally as an accessory mineral in granite pegmatites, but can also be found in carbonatites, and as detritus in placer deposits. It is paramagnetic, and …

Columbite-tantalite minerals commonly have a broad range of U contents that may reach several thousand ppm and may substitute for Fe and Mn into the crystal lattice, but for high U contents may form phases of its own (e.g., uraninite; cf. Romer et al., 1996). Furthermore, columbite-tantalite minerals typically have very low common Pb …
